What Is the Homestead Exemption in Berkley?
Quick, Definitive Answer
The homestead exemption in Berkley, Michigan, is a tax break that frees homeowners from paying 18 mills of school operating taxes on their main home. This can save you over $2,000 each year, depending on your property's value. To qualify, you must file the needed paperwork with the city assessor within 45 days of closing on your home. This exemption aims to make owning a home more affordable for Berkley residents. It also helps keep neighborhoods stable by encouraging long-term stays. How the Homestead Exemption Works in Berkley
Key Details and Process Steps
To claim the homestead exemption in Berkley, follow these key steps:
- Make sure the property is your main home.
- Fill out the Principal Residence Exemption (PRE) Affidavit.
- Submit the affidavit to the Berkley city assessor's office within 45 days of closing.
- Check that your exemption status is approved.
Complete these steps quickly to get the full tax benefits. Missing the filing deadline could mean a delay or loss of the exemption for that year. It's also wise to keep a copy of your submission for your records. This can help if any issues come up with your application. Common Mistakes and Expert Tips
Mistakes to Avoid
One common mistake homeowners make is not filing the exemption paperwork on time. This oversight can mean missing out on big tax savings for the year. Another pitfall is not checking that the property is listed as the main home, which is needed for eligibility. Also, incorrect or incomplete information on the affidavit can lead to processing delays or denial of the exemption. It's crucial to update your exemption status if you move or change your main home. Forgetting to do so can result in penalties or losing the exemption. Additionally, some homeowners overlook notifying the assessor's office of changes in ownership, which can affect their exemption status.
